Abstract
This Project presents a double aim: to map the spatial distribution of the supporter fans association in the metropolitan region of São Paulo city, as well as to offer a social profile of the organized supporters. With a spotlight on the struggle dynamic between the rival groups of soccer fandom, we aim to understand the logic of the spread of the clubs communities feeling of identity in the inner city, focusing on the subgroups of associated fans, that take part in Torcidas organizations.The methodology is based on a reasearch with qualities and quantitatives sources, already developed by the proponent in the universe of supporter associations in Rio de Janeiro. The application of the questionnaires and the collection of the material during the Paulista and Brazilian Championship of 2014 season will be added to the record of about forty hours of testimonials in Oral History within the leaders of the fans associations in the capital city. The research will provide a socio-spatial phenomenon analysis of the identity with the original regions of the supporters, with the creation of the sources to seek the territorial ramification of the respective subgroups and to the reflection on the problematic of the youth violence that surround the professional soccer, as the studies already made by Toledo (1996), Pimenta (1997) and Reis (2006), between others specialists. If it has been already examined the historical, anthropological and sociological bases of the fans associations, we aim to join to the academic researches new statistic information's, typical from the qualities and quantitative evaluations, that allow the comprehension of the urban net of the supporters clubs, in the space of the excluding new arenas, dimensioned to the realization of the sports mega events and redirected to receive new economic statements and new soccer audience in the country after 2014.Finally, it is important to stress that the Project will give continuity to the institutional partnership with the Soccer Museum, realized in the previous project supported by FAPESP, taking in consideration that it fits on axe of research already started by the Center of Reference of Brazilian Soccer, CRBS, link to the mentioned institution, dedicated to the collection of ethnographic information about the organized fans in the São Paulo city.
